                                • olivierlambertO Offline
                                  olivierlambert Vates 🪐 Co-Founder CEO
                                  last edited by olivierlambert

                                  1. Visit your host/pool master URL (like https://<master-ip-address>) and validate the self-signed certificate
                                  2. Then enter this URL in your browser: https://lite.xen-orchestra.com/#/?master=<master-ip-address>
                                  3. Profit

                                        • P Offline
                                          peder @saneece
                                          last edited by

                                          @saneece The XO Lite installing instructions say that you should run this command on your xcp-ng server

                                          wget https://lite.xen-orchestra.com/ -O /opt/xensource/www/xolite.html
                                          

                                          You seem to have omitted the -O /opt/xensource/www/xolite.html part, since your screenshot talks about "Saving as index.html", and that's why you can't go to HOST_URL/xolite.html
